How do you obtain a Global Blue Card? I applied online, paid the fee ($100), and completed the TSA in-person interview upon arrival at the Philadelphia airport. My AA credit card covered the cost of the application.
After you receive your Global Entry card in the mail, take a photo of it. Keep a record of it. When it is time to travel, show your card at check-in so you guarantee pre-check.

Do I need an appointment to complete the application?
I didn’t need an appointment because the calendar was backed up for one year so they waived the requirement to have an appointment so you can complete the interview at specific international airports in the US. The interview took about 15 minutes. I needed my NJ driver’s license and current passport. I was electronically fingerprinted. I answered a few questions. I was asked if I was ever arrested in the US.
How do you know if you are approved?
One week later, I received an email that I was approved. I should receive my Global Entry card in the mail shortly. The card is valid for 5 years.
How do you use the card?
When you enter the US or fly domestically, you go to a Global Entry kiosk and scan yourself in. You don’t have to wait in line for TSA or passport checks. It fast-tracks you in a few minutes. I am so excited. I have waited for hours in the TSA and passport lines over the past 36 years of traveling.
Do I still need a TSA Pre-Check?
The agent also told me that I didn’t need a TSA Pre-Check. Global Entry gives you a precheck.
Who can apply for Global Entry?
Global Entry is open to U.S. citizens, U.S. nationals, and U.S. legal permanent residents as well as citizens of certain countries with which CBP has trusted traveler arrangements, including Argentina, Colombia, Germany, India, Mexico, the Netherlands, Panama, the Republic of Korea, Singapore, Switzerland, and the United Kingdom. Canadian citizens and residents enrolled in NEXUS may also use the Global Entry kiosks.

Are You Eligible?
U.S. citizens, U.S. lawful permanent residents, and citizens of the following countries are eligible for Global Entry membership:
Citizens of Argentina
Citizens of Brazil
Citizens of Bahrain
Citizens of India
Citizens of Colombia
Citizens of the United Kingdom
Citizens of Germany
Citizens of The Netherlands
Citizens of Panama
Citizens of Singapore
Citizens of South Korea
Citizens of Switzerland
Citizens of Taiwan
Mexican nationals
Airports with Global Entry Kiosks
75 International airports currently have a Global Entry Kiosk. Most airports with kiosks are located in the United States.
